Suppose we have a multiprogrammed computer in which each job has identical characteristics. In one computation period, T for a job, the first half of the time is spent in IO and the second half in processor activity. Each job runs for a total of N periods. Assume a simple roundrobin scheduling is used. Roundrobin scheduling simply means that each job is scheduled one after the other in repeating sequence. Also, assume IO operations can overlap with processor operation. You will be providing formulas for different quantities in terms of T and N The formulas you will be defining are for:
Turnaround time: The actual total time to complete all jobs.
Processor utilization: Ratio of the time that the processor is active not waiting
